WebJan 13, 2024 · The good news is that an unopened bottle of soy sauce is good for 2-3 years, and possibly longer. Most opened bottles of soy sauce are safe for at least a year thanks to the high salt content. However, the flavor may change over time, so if the soy sauce doesn’t seem as good as it used to be, it may be time to splurge on a fresh bottle. This was the first study to report the impacts … WebSep 21, 2024 · As for soy sauce, the direct contribution of peptides to its taste is negligible due to the relatively low content . In addition, some amino acids (arginine, aspartic acid, and glutamic acid) and salt can act as bitterness suppressors [ 39 , 40 ].
